Charity Information
The Howe Trust (Wheatley) provides small grants for local people in need, and care for 26 acres of land. The land, which is known collectively as The Howe, includes some 100 allotments, a small orchard and memorial tree area as well as grassland, hedgerows and woodland. Working with other local and charitable organisations, we manage the land for bio diversity and the benefit of the community.
